Frequently Asked Questions

Do badass names actually suit beagle temperaments?

Yes—female beagles are pack hunters with strong prey drives, stubborn independence, and fearless personalities. They ignore commands to follow scents, challenge other dogs, and won't back down. Badass names reflect this actual breed behavior perfectly, rather than fighting against their nature.

What makes a name work for female beagles specifically?

Strong one or two-syllable names with hard consonants (S, Z, R, K, V) cut through noise better than soft names—useful for recall in the field. Female beagles especially respond well to names with personality; they're independent thinkers who need names matching their attitude.

Are these names too aggressive for a pet?

No. Badass means strong, confident, and fearless—not mean or dangerous. Names like Scout, Storm, and Ranger reflect real beagle traits without suggesting aggression. Many well-behaved, friendly dogs wear tough names because personality, not name, determines behavior.
